The Pane Cunzato Festival in Misiliscemi

The Pane Cunzato Festival is one of the culinary highlights of the summer in Misiliscemi, a municipality in the province of Trapani, Sicily. Born from the union of eight local districts—including Salinagrande, Guarrato, Rilievo, Marausa, Locogrande, Palma, Pietretagliate, and Fontanasalsa—Misiliscemi is a young community that has chosen to promote its folk traditions through a packed calendar of summer festivals. The event is dedicated to one of the symbols of Sicilian peasant cuisine: pane cunzato, literally "seasoned bread".

Pane cunzato, a classic of Sicilian tradition

Pane cunzato originated as a simple, hearty peasant dish: a loaf of durum wheat bread, often still warm, sliced open and seasoned with extra virgin olive oil, fresh tomatoes, oregano, salt, salted anchovies, and primosale or pecorino cheese. Every family has its own recipe, and this variety makes the festival a perfect opportunity to rediscover the authentic flavors of the Trapani area, between the sea and the countryside.

Atmosphere and program

The event typically takes place on a summer evening, with stalls preparing the seasoned bread on the spot, accompanied by live music. The festival is part of the "Sere d'Estate" (Summer Evenings) program promoted by the Misiliscemi municipal administration, a series of events running from June to September across the various districts, alternating concerts, theatrical performances, sports events, and traditional festivals dedicated to local products, such as the Watermelon Festival and the Pane Cunzato Festival itself.

  • Tasting of pane cunzato prepared according to the traditional recipe
  • Food stalls featuring local specialties
  • Folk music and evening entertainment in the open air
  • A festive evening for residents and visitors in the local districts

Practical information — Pane Cunzato Festival

How to get there

Misiliscemi is located in western Sicily, south of Trapani. By car, it can be reached via the SS115 or the A29 motorway (Trapani/Marsala exit). Trapani-Birgi Airport (Vincenzo Florio) is just a few minutes from the southern districts of the municipality.

When

The festival is usually held in the summer, typically in August, as part of the municipality's "Sere d'Estate" program.

Tips

Admission and participation in municipal festivals are generally free; tastings are paid for directly at the stalls. For updated dates and locations, it is recommended to check the official channels of the Municipality of Misiliscemi.
